[0125] The present invention provides an intraosseous (IO) device and method for penetrating bone and entering the associated marrow for medical procedures such as aspiration and biopsy of the marrow. The term "intraosseous (IO) device" in this application includes, but is not limited to, any hollow needle, hollow drill, piercer assembly, bone piercer, catheter, cannula operable to provide access to the intraosseous space or inside the bone , trocar, stylet, inner trocar, outer penetrator, IO needle, biopsy needle, aspiration needle, IO needle set, biopsy needle set, or aspiration needle set. In addition, a wide variety of other IO devices can be formed in accordance with one or more teachings of the present invention. The IO device may be formed at least in part from metal alloys such as 304 stainless steel and other biocompatible materials associated with needles and similar medical devices.

Abstract

Penetrator assemblies operable to provide access to an intraosseous space are disclosed. The penetrator assembly may include a flexible outer penetrator having a longitudinal bore and a distal end operable to penetrate bone and associated bone marrow. The penetrator assembly may also include a rigid inner penetrator including a distal end operable to penetrate bone and associated bone marrow. A hub having a distal end is connected to a proximal end of the flexible outer penetrator. A connector having a distal end is connected to a proximal end of the rigid inner penetrator. A proximal end of the connector can releasably engage a driver. The longitudinal bore of the flexible outer penetrator can removably receive the rigid inner penetrator to prevent or minimize the flexible outer penetrator from bending during an insertion procedure. The flexible outer penetrator can bend after removal of the rigid inner penetrator from the longitudinal bore.

[0001] Cross References to Related Applications [0002] This application claims the benefit of priority to U.S. Provisional Patent Application No. 62 / 670,691, filed May 11, 2018, the entire disclosure of which is incorporated herein by reference. technical field [0003] The present application relates generally to a medical device for accessing the intraosseous space, and more particularly, to an intraosseous device and method for penetrating bone and entering the associated marrow for medical procedures. Background technique [0004] An important factor in treating critically ill patients is the rapid establishment of intravenous (IV) access to administer drugs and fluids directly into the circulatory system. Whether in a paramedic's ambulance or an emergency specialist's emergency room, the purpose is the same: to initiate an IV to administer life-saving medications and fluids.
